Ini adalah Panduan Pengembang AWS CDK v2. CDK v1 yang lebih lama memasuki pemeliharaan pada 1 Juni 2022 dan mengakhiri dukungan pada 1 Juni 2023.
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.
Lengkapi semua prasyarat sebelum memulai dengan. AWS Cloud Development Kit (AWS CDK)
Siapkan Akun AWS
Jika Anda atau organisasi Anda baru AWS, Anda harus mengaturnya Akun AWS. Ini termasuk mendaftar untuk Akun AWS, mengamankan pengguna root Anda, menentukan metode Anda mengelola pengguna, dan membuat pengguna administratif. Untuk mengelola pengguna, Anda dapat menggunakan AWS Identity and Access Management (IAM) atau AWS IAM Identity Center. Kami menyarankan Anda menggunakan IAM Identity Center. Untuk informasi selengkapnya, lihat berikut ini:
-
Apa itu IAM? di Panduan Pengguna IAM.
-
Apa itu Pusat Identitas IAM? dalam AWS IAM Identity Center User Guide.
Setelah menyiapkan AWS akun, Anda harus memiliki pengguna administratif dan kemampuan untuk membuat dan mengelola pengguna tambahan menggunakan IAM atau IAM Identity Center.
Sebelum bergerak maju, kami menyarankan Anda meluangkan waktu untuk mempelajari praktik terbaik yang direkomendasikan di AWS Identity and Access Management. Untuk informasi selengkapnya, lihat Praktik terbaik keamanan dan kasus penggunaan AWS Identity and Access Management di Panduan Pengguna IAM.
Instal dan konfigurasikan AWS CLI
Saat Anda mengembangkan AWS CDK aplikasi di mesin lokal Anda, Anda akan menggunakan Antarmuka Baris AWS Cloud Development Kit (AWS CDK) Perintah (CLI) untuk berinteraksi dengan AWS, seperti menyebarkan aplikasi untuk menyediakan AWS sumber daya Anda. Untuk berinteraksi dengan AWS luar AWS Management Console, Anda harus mengonfigurasi kredensi keamanan di komputer lokal Anda. Untuk melakukan ini, kami sarankan Anda menginstal dan menggunakan AWS Command Line Interface (AWS CLI).
Untuk petunjuk cara menginstal AWS CLI, lihat Menginstal atau memperbarui ke versi terbaru dari Panduan AWS Command Line Interface Pengguna. AWS CLI
Cara Anda mengonfigurasi kredensi keamanan akan bergantung pada cara Anda atau organisasi Anda mengelola pengguna. Untuk petunjuk, lihat Otentikasi dan akses kredensional di Panduan Pengguna.AWS Command Line Interface
Setelah menginstal dan mengkonfigurasi AWS CLI, Anda harus memiliki yang berikut:
-
Yang AWS CLI diinstal pada mesin lokal Anda.
-
Kredenal yang dikonfigurasi di mesin lokal Anda menggunakan file.
config
AWS CLI
Menginstal Node.js dan prasyarat bahasa pemrograman
Semua AWS CDK pengembang, terlepas dari bahasa pemrograman yang didukung yang akan Anda gunakan, memerlukan Node.js
penting
Node.js versi 13.0.0 hingga 13.6.0 tidak kompatibel dengan AWS CDK karena masalah kompatibilitas dengan dependensinya.
Prasyarat bahasa pemrograman lainnya tergantung pada bahasa yang akan Anda gunakan untuk mengembangkan aplikasi: AWS CDK
-
TypeScript 3.8 atau lebih baru ()
npm -g install typescript
Pengakhiran bahasa pihak ketiga
Setiap versi bahasa hanya didukung sampai EOL (End Of Life) dan dapat berubah sewaktu-waktu dengan pemberitahuan sebelumnya.
Langkah selanjutnya
Untuk memulai dengan AWS CDK, lihatMemulai dengan AWS CDK.